
ALEXANDER MCQ98
ALEXANDER MCQ98

ALEXANDER MCQ14
$ 175.75
ALEXANDER MCQ24
$ 175.75
ALEXANDER MCQ155
$ 175.75
ALEXANDER MCQ158
$ 175.75
ALEXANDER MCQ93
$ 175.75
ALEXANDER MCQ104
$ 175.75
ALEXANDER MCQ115
$ 175.75
ALEXANDER MCQ129
$ 175.75
English








